An analysis of error-correction procedures during discrimination training.

Summary
Error-correction procedures in behavioral acquisition were studied. Some developmentally delayed subjects improved more with specific error-correction methods, suggesting these procedures can have multiple functions.

Background:
- Understanding error-correction mechanisms is crucial for effective behavioral acquisition strategies.
- Previous research has not fully delineated the specific functions of different error-correction procedures.
- Developmentally delayed individuals may benefit from tailored error-correction techniques.
Purpose of the Study:
- To investigate the mechanisms underlying error-correction procedures during behavioral acquisition.
- To compare the efficacy of different error-correction conditions in match-to-sample discrimination training.
- To identify the functional components of error-correction procedures.
Main Methods:
- A multielement design was used with seven developmentally delayed subjects.
- Three conditions were implemented: baseline (differential reinforcement), practice (error repetition), and avoidance (irrelevant stimuli after error).
- Correct responses were reinforced with praise and edibles/tokens.
Main Results:
- All subjects showed progress in the baseline condition.
- Five out of seven subjects performed better under one of the error-correction conditions.
- Two subjects improved more in the practice condition, while three improved more in the avoidance condition.
Conclusions:
- Error-correction procedures can serve multiple functions in behavioral acquisition.
- The practice condition likely involved both avoidance and stimulus control.
- Future acquisition studies should incorporate control procedures to identify specific behavioral mechanisms.
